Output 24efbe64cecd7def48855f8eeed4305caf54ded5a24c526ff3beb10acb356555:25

value
76561
script pubkey
OP_0 OP_PUSHBYTES_20 bddd1828a5959acff5f41c09c2ec2e27330990fa
address
bc1qhhw3s299jkdvla05rsyu9mpwyuesny86unru8y
transaction
24efbe64cecd7def48855f8eeed4305caf54ded5a24c526ff3beb10acb356555
spent
true